Maintaining wellness does not have to be complicated or time-consuming.
By incorporating simple habits into daily life, anyone can improve physical health, mental clarity, and overall well-being.
These habits can be adapted to individual routines, schedules, and preferences, making it easy to start at any time and sustain over the long term.
Starting the day with movement sets a positive tone for wellness. Gentle stretching, yoga, or a brisk walk can awaken the body, improve circulation, and enhance flexibility. Morning activity stimulates energy levels and supports a productive day. Even a few minutes of focused movement can improve mood and create a foundation for more extensive wellness practices. Hydration is a fundamental habit for maintaining health. Drinking water throughout the day helps regulate body temperature, supports digestion, and promotes mental alertness. Starting the day with a glass of water replenishes fluids lost overnight and sets a mindful approach to hydration. Including water-rich foods such as fruits and vegetables complements fluid intake and contributes to overall wellness. Balanced nutrition is another key wellness habit. Eating a variety of f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, whole grains, and healthy fats provides the body with essential nutrients. Simple adjustments, like adding a serving of vegetables to each meal or choosing whole grains, can improve digestion, energy levels, and long-term health.
